The number of bear attacks in Japan reached a record high between April 2025 and March 2026, with 13 people killed and more than 220 injured. This is a sharp increase compared to the same period last year, when three people were killed and 82 injured, and authorities are on high alert as autumn, the peak of bear feeding season, approaches.
The increase in bear encounters in Japan can be traced to the shrinking of rural areas after World War II, when millions of young people began moving to cities. “The boundaries between town and forest have become increasingly blurred for bears as farmland that once provided a buffer against bear invasions has been lost,” said Liam Adcock, a wildlife researcher at the Nagano-based Picchio Wildlife Research Center.
He added that stricter hunting regulations and a decline in hunting populations have made it possible for Japan’s two native bears, the Ezo brown bear and Asiatic black bear, to breed. It is estimated that there are more than 57,000 bears in the country.
Climate change is exacerbating the problem. Adcock said the vegetables, fruits and acorns the bears depend on grow later in the season and are becoming increasingly scarce. “But they know that one food source remains the same: human waste.”
This has brought hungry bears closer to cities than ever before, with 50,000 bear sightings recorded last year.
In its 2026 Environment White Paper, the government relaxed bear hunting rules and introduced a roadmap to control the population, while describing bears as a “serious threat to public safety and peace”. The plan aims to reduce bear populations in many prefectures to 62-67% of their current levels by 2030 through culling.
Mr Adcock said cultural trends still favor coexistence, but priorities had shifted to ensuring immediate public safety and responding effectively to threats.
“Fireworks are often set off in cities to scare away bears,” Adcock said. “But when that’s not enough, police and military are called in. This often equates to euthanizing the bear, especially during the day and there are people around.”
“We want to show that coexistence through non-lethal management, including technology, is completely achievable,” he added.
Areas where bears are more likely to be encountered, such as Gunma, Toyama, and Ishikawa, have begun installing behavior monitoring cameras in forests around residential areas that use AI to identify bears and notify local authorities. The system, developed by Hokuriku Electric Power Co. in conjunction with telecommunications company Kitadori, allows authorities to alert local residents and take steps to keep the bears away from the town, according to reports.
In Hokkaido, KDDI SmartDrone has set up a drone port in the town of Shintotsukawa, where the drone can fly within 10 minutes of sighting a bear and track it until rescue arrives. Non-lethal methods are usually preferred to scare away bears.
AI and drones are “very efficient for detection and very useful for deterrence,” Adcock said. The technology has proven effective in other parts of the world, including the United States, and a small study in 2024 found that drones in Montana were successful in driving bears away from human settlements 91% of the time.
However, this technique is not practical for individuals trying to keep bears off their property. That’s where the solar-powered animatronic “Monster Wolf” comes into play. The $4,000 robot was originally developed to protect crops by imitating the cry of the extinct Japanese wolf to scare away bears.
Motohiro Miyasaka, executive director of Wolf Kamuy, which sells the robot, told CNN that sales have doubled “in response to the frequent sightings of bears in urban areas in Japan since last year.”
The company is developing a portable 8-inch plush version for “those who enjoy mountain stream fishing, camping, and hiking,” Miyasaka said. “Monster Wolf Mini is expected to be tested around the end of 2026.”
But Tokyo-based engineer Daniel Coca says these systems are not a silver bullet. “Using AI, drones and robots costs a lot of money,” he told CNN. “They are not easy to build, use, and scale across the country,” he said, adding that while they save lives in some cases, they do not provide immediate information to local residents or hikers.
In August 2025, a climber was attacked and killed by a bear on Mt. Rausu in Hokkaido, prompting Koca to investigate data on bear incidents across the country. “There was no single practical place where you could check for risk,” he said. “There was already a lot of bear information in Japan, but it was scattered across many local sources. Prefectures and municipalities issued reports in a variety of formats, including PDFs, local maps, Excel files, press notices, and Japanese-only pages. This made it difficult to identify one route or one destination.”
Determined to make public information available to people before they go out, he founded Kumamap, a bear tracking service. Koca claims the app supports coexistence, using local government data, national news, and verified community reporting. “If people understand the risks, they can better prepare and avoid surprises,” he says. “Kumamap is helping people make better decisions in bear habitat.” As of early August, the app had nearly 6 million users and tracked 156,631 public bear incident records, including 821 reviewed community records.
Adcock recognizes the potential of technology to protect bears, but emphasizes that most of the time, people on the ground are needed to address the problem.
Therefore, the Picchio Wildlife Research Center recommends the use of Japan’s unique “deterrence technology”, the bear dog. “Japan used to breed semi-feral dogs (which naturally drove bears away from cities),” Adcock said, adding that the organization uses Finnish Karelian Bear Dogs to reduce human-bear conflicts by tracking, barking and chasing bears away from residential areas without harming them.
“Even though the bear encounter rate is almost double what it was last year, the towns we work with have the lowest bear encounter rates on record in a long time,” he said. “This method is effective and I hope more regions and countries will take notice of it. Generally speaking, the way Japan is efficiently introducing new technologies and non-lethal methods like bear dog is something other countries should learn from.”
